Aluminum tube use for mop handle sand blasted anodized

Aluminum tube use for mop handle sand blasted anodized

Short Description:

Material: 6063-T5

Diameter: 16-32mm

Thickness: 0.8-1.0mm

Length: 1.2-1.8m or customized

Surface Treatment: Sand-blazed anodized

Aluminum tubes are versatile and widely used in various industries due to their lightweight, durable, and corrosion-resistant properties. One popular application of aluminum tubes is in the manufacturing of mop handles. These handles are often subjected to harsh conditions, including exposure to moisture, chemicals, and repeated use, making them prone to wear and corrosion.

 

To enhance their performance and aesthetic appeal, aluminum tubes for mop handles can undergo a sand blasted anodized finish.

 

Sand blasting is a surface preparation technique that involves propelling abrasive materials, such as sand or aluminum oxide particles, at high speeds onto the aluminum tube’s surface. This process removes any impurities, oxide layers, or blemishes, creating a clean, uniform, and slightly roughened surface. Sand blasting improves the adhesion of subsequent coatings and provides a consistent surface texture for anodizing.

 

Anodizing is an electrochemical process that forms a protective oxide layer on the aluminum’s surface, increasing its resistance to corrosion, wear, and scratches. The anodizing process involves immersing the sand blasted aluminum tube in an electrolytic solution and applying an electric current. This causes a controlled oxidation reaction, resulting in the formation of a stable and dense aluminum oxide layer on the surface of the tube. Anodizing can be performed in various colors, with clear or matte finishes being commonly used for mop handles.

 

The sand blasted anodized finish provides several benefits for mop handles. Firstly, it enhances the handle’s durability by forming a robust protective layer that acts as a barrier against moisture, chemicals, and physical abrasion. This extends the lifespan of the mop handle, making it more resistant to rust and corrosion. Secondly, the sand blasted surface texture improves grip and handling, allowing for a secure and comfortable grip during use. Additionally, the anodized finish can be customized to match specific branding or aesthetic requirements, adding a professional and appealing appearance to the mop handle.
